Does carbon monoxide cause nose bleeds?  
How long does it take for carbon monoxide to come out of your blood?

On July 12, 2007 is had an Arterial blood gas test done and there were higher than normal levels of carbon monoxide in my blood.  I was work at a Auto Auction and started August 1, 2006.  Around December of 2006 I started getting sick when I went ot work, I worked two days a week and then after I got off work I would go home and sleep for hours and days.  I would have a headache, nauses, blurred vision, chest pains, nose bleeds (sometimes), etc,  It was not until June 11, 2007 that I told my husband what was going on.  I also told my employer and they just said it was my imagation.
